typedef struct {
CRbitvalue dirty[CR_MAX_BITARRAY];
/* pixel pack/unpack */
CRbitvalue pack[CR_MAX_BITARRAY];
CRbitvalue unpack[CR_MAX_BITARRAY];
/* vertex array */
CRbitvalue enableClientState[CR_MAX_BITARRAY];
CRbitvalue clientPointer[CR_MAX_BITARRAY];
CRbitvalue *v; /* vertex */
CRbitvalue *n; /* normal */
CRbitvalue *c; /* color */
CRbitvalue *i; /* index */
CRbitvalue *t[CR_MAX_TEXTURE_UNITS]; /* texcoord */
CRbitvalue *e; /* edgeflag */
CRbitvalue *s; /* secondary color */
CRbitvalue *f; /* fog coord */
#ifdef CR_NV_vertex_program
CRbitvalue *a[CR_MAX_VERTEX_ATTRIBS]; /* NV_vertex_program */
#endif
} CRClientBits;
/*
* NOTE!!!! If you change this structure, search through the code for
* occurances of 'defaultPacking' and fix the static initializations!!!!
*/
typedef struct {
GLint rowLength;
GLint skipRows;
GLint skipPixels;
GLint alignment;
GLint imageHeight;
GLint skipImages;
GLboolean swapBytes;
GLboolean psLSBFirst; /* don't conflict with crap from Xlib.h */
} CRPixelPackState;
typedef struct {
unsigned char *p;
GLint size;
GLint type;
GLint stride;
GLboolean enabled;
GLboolean normalized; /* Added with GL_ARB_vertex_program */
int bytesPerIndex;
#ifdef CR_ARB_vertex_buffer_object
CRBufferObject *buffer;
#endif
#ifdef CR_EXT_compiled_vertex_array
GLboolean locked;
unsigned char *prevPtr;
GLint prevStride;
#endif
} CRClientPointer;
typedef struct {
CRClientPointer v; /* vertex */
CRClientPointer n; /* normal */
CRClientPointer c; /* color */
CRClientPointer i; /* color index */
CRClientPointer t[CR_MAX_TEXTURE_UNITS]; /* texcoords */
CRClientPointer e; /* edge flags */
CRClientPointer s; /* secondary color */
CRClientPointer f; /* fog coord */
#ifdef CR_NV_vertex_program
CRClientPointer a[CR_MAX_VERTEX_ATTRIBS]; /* vertex attribs */
#endif
#ifdef CR_NV_vertex_array_range
GLboolean arrayRange;
GLboolean arrayRangeValid;
void *arrayRangePointer;
GLuint arrayRangeLength;
#endif
#ifdef CR_EXT_compiled_vertex_array
GLint lockFirst;
GLint lockCount;
GLboolean locked;
# ifdef IN_GUEST
GLboolean synced;
# endif
#endif
} CRVertexArrays;
#define CRSTATECLIENT_MAX_VERTEXARRAYS (7+CR_MAX_TEXTURE_UNITS+CR_MAX_VERTEX_ATTRIBS)
typedef struct {
/* pixel pack/unpack */
CRPixelPackState pack;
CRPixelPackState unpack;
CRVertexArrays array;
GLint curClientTextureUnit;
/* state stacks (glPush/PopClientState) */
GLint attribStackDepth;
CRbitvalue pushMaskStack[CR_MAX_CLIENT_ATTRIB_STACK_DEPTH];
GLint pixelStoreStackDepth;
CRPixelPackState pixelPackStoreStack[CR_MAX_CLIENT_ATTRIB_STACK_DEPTH];
CRPixelPackState pixelUnpackStoreStack[CR_MAX_CLIENT_ATTRIB_STACK_DEPTH];
GLint vertexArrayStackDepth;
CRVertexArrays vertexArrayStack[CR_MAX_CLIENT_ATTRIB_STACK_DEPTH];
} CRClientState;
